Output 264768c6106bb0ef8f29c91fae226f56e58b8ebe49495d49d1e5463676523f13:3

value
95031000
script pubkey
OP_0 OP_PUSHBYTES_20 6d89bf53a4c2caf36cad7d32e5c775e6ac268e50
address
bc1qdkym75ayct90xm9d05ewt3m4u6kzdrjspqlg69
transaction
264768c6106bb0ef8f29c91fae226f56e58b8ebe49495d49d1e5463676523f13
spent
true